Chapter 5

Everything ~

EVELYN

Pain can kill.

And I'm not talking about physical pain but emotional pain.

I almost died years ago, and when I survived that heart-wrenching moment, I promised myself never to get involved with anything that would put me in that state again.

That's why when my father wanted to buy me a beautiful British cat, I declined it.

What if it died? Or one day abandon me for someone else?

Pets were cute and loving, but they could go and never come back, or they might get hit by a car.

I thought of every possible scenario that would make me cry and decided against it.

"Eat slowly and drink water," Vee says, putting more rice on my plate.

"Will you tell me why you're in my small apartment? Sulking?"

"I just felt...disturbed and sad today. Nothing happened; I just felt sad, and I decided to come see you." I say—lie to her face and watch her smile.

"Eat more; I'll get you more stew. You can eat to your heart's desire; we're not in Albion where you eat less and exercise more. Tueh!" She rolls her eyes, and I laugh.

We Albion women were trained to eat less and exercise more to keep our bodies fit for a capable suitor.

"You make it sound so bad." I laugh.

"Oh please, didn't you see Athena last year, during the Fay dance? She looked so skinny, I honestly thought she would break when she was called to dance for the night."

"And she looked very happy." I remind her.

"Oh please, she can never look displeased. Feed her poop and ask her how she is, and she'll tell you her day is going well." I burst into another laugh.

Coughing and laughing, as tears run down my eyes.

"Oh, my God." Vee joins me in laughing, and I sigh, grateful I have a good cover to cry.

I clean my eyes and take the plates to the kitchen.

"Have you painted anything recently?" Vee asks.

"No. Why?"

"I need to hang a painting in this apartment; it feels soulless."

I look around the room. It does feel soulless, as though it doesn't house a human.

"I will have a painting sent out to you, Milady." I bow slightly, and she does the same.

~•~

I stretch my arms and heave a deep sigh of relief as I hear a crack.

I break my neck gently, and I suddenly feel more relaxed than I have been these past few days.

Exams are fast approaching, and Vee and I were planning to have our holiday in Florida, enjoying sunlight and freedom.

"Ms Evelyn?" I looked up from my mat.

I was in yoga class with a few females from my class and other seniors.

"Hello, Sir, good morning." I greet.

"They weren't lying when they said Lady Evelyn was the prettiest of them all." He says, and I laugh, thanking him.

Mr Shaw directs me to his office, and when I was done and rightly clothed, I waited for him to tell me why he brought me to his office.

"So, we're having a mural painting of the Hockey team. You know CrownFord University has exceeded many Universities in the past years in Hockey and many other things, so we want a mural of our stars somewhere fancy for the whole world to see, but first, we want it in our school Wall of Fame." He explains.

I nod; that's actually a good one for publicity, but he is yet to tell me why I'm here.

"So we want you to paint the boys." He says.

"I heard from Ms Seth that you are a great artist. I hope you help us with this. An artistry student of CrownFord University painting CrownFord University and New York Hockey stars. Imagine the influence." He continues.

Painting the hockey players means I'll have to paint him too. Stay within an inch close to him, talking to him and—

Definitely not.

"I don't think I can pull this off. It's too much of a task." I say.

"We talked to your parents about it first, Ms Evelyn, and they were so delighted. And we would be grateful, and of course we'll pay you for the trouble."

It's been so long since I last held a paintbrush. How long? Six months? Nine? Or more?

"I'll think about it," I assure him.

••

I leave Mr Shaw’s office with my head spinning.

"How can you tell everyone you never had a first love? I thought I was your first love; you wound me, Alex." I hear the familiar voice say as I round the corner and step out of the lounge of the teacher's block.

"Don't you have class, Tiffany? I've been indulging your bullshit for so long, and you think we're romantically together?" Alexander picks up his phone and scrolls through, not batting an eyelash in her direction.

She rolls her eyes and turns to me, and I look away instantly.

Students sit at each table, writing and chatting away.

"Evelyn." I hiss and turn to the voice. I didn't want them to acknowledge me.

It is a classmate. Her name is Rose, and we share the same table. She's sweet and a nerd.

"I'm so sorry for taking your notebook yesterday without permission. I was so tired and didn't have it in me to find you. Are you okay though?" She asks.

I nod, confused.

"Yeah, why?"

"Kieran said he saw you crying yesterday. Outside the interview hall." She drops, and I swear the whole room stops talking, and I wish the ground could open and let me fall inside, peacefully.
